Image Ibarra Rocha; Andrea Direction, Script Andrea Ibarra Rocha, born in Mexico City (2000), is a photographer and director graduated with honors from Centro de Diseño, Cine y Televisión. She debuted in October 2023 at the Morelia International Film Festival as a director of "Totó", as a producer of "Amanita", and as an art director of "Ha". She was 2nd AD in "Nada que ver" the latest film by Kenya Márquez, and is currently supervising cinematography at the stop motion studio "Cinema Fantasma" for the film "Frankelda y el Príncipe de los Sustos".
